Medical Document Types Requiring Translation

Patient Information and Education Resources

Making sure patients understand their health issues, available treatments, and care instructions completely depends on accurate translations in items they interact with. These resources contain educational information, discharge instructions, consent forms, and brochures. By enabling people to make educated decisions about their treatment, accurate and clear translations enhance results and build confidence in medical professionals.

Clinical Research and Trials

Clinical trial documentation and research papers depend heavily on accurate translations. This covers patient questionnaires, study procedures, informed consent forms, and research results. Precise translations guarantee that all study participants understand all the information and that the international medical community can reliably duplicate and evaluate the research. Ensuring ethical requirements are fulfilled and preserving the integrity of clinical research depend on this accuracy.

Documents Related to Regulation and Compliance

Forms for compliance and regulatory submissions need accurate translations. These include paperwork sent in to health authorities for registration of medical devices, drug approvals, and adherence to international health standards. Correct translations guarantee that these documents satisfy the strict standards of regulatory agencies, which helps to prevent delays or rejections and guarantees that items can be sold legally and safely in many locations.

Challenges and Solutions

Technical constraints, assuring consistency, and linguistic subtleties are only a few of the difficulties in incorporating medical translations into web construction. Inaccuracies in translation of medical terminology can result from linguistic subtleties. Working with qualified medical translators who speak both the source and target languages well is crucial to resolving issues, as is using translation memory techniques to keep terminology consistent.

Multilingual content layout and design can be thrown off by technical constraints like problems with character encoding and text expansion. One way to lessen these problems is to use multilingual content management systems (CMS) and make sure web developers are conversant with internationalization (i18n) and localization (l10n) best practices. Accuracy and clarity depend on medical terminology being consistent throughout many documents.

Uniformity is maintained in part by using translation management systems (TMS) that save glossaries and translation memory.
